kneeling in wayward meditation along with wandering prayer
thinking i'm the king's esteemed vizier and trusted soothsayer

no longer able to navigate the cold, winding stairs of the watchtower
especially at a dark, ungodly, candleless hour

i keep vigil as deep feelings and emotions fester
turns out i'm nothing more than an unsummoned, court jester

i dance alone in motley threads
whilst out in the courtyard they're taking heads
beyond moats and behind thick stone walls, kings toss and turn 'neath robed, tarnished, ill-weaved covers as betrayal embeds
turns out that there are more uses than i ever imagined for royal bedspreads
